From: Alexei Starovoitov <ast@kernel.org>

Since the combination of valid upper bits in slab->obj_exts with
OBJEXTS_ALLOC_FAIL bit can never happen,
use OBJEXTS_ALLOC_FAIL == (1ull << 0) as a magic sentinel
instead of (1ull << 2) to free up bit 2.

Signed-off-by: Alexei Starovoitov <ast@kernel.org>
Are we low on bits that we need to do this or is this good to have
optimization but not required?
That's a good question. After this change MEMCG_DATA_OBJEXTS and
OBJEXTS_ALLOC_FAIL will have the same value and they are used with the
same field (page->memcg_data and slab->obj_exts are aliases). Even if
page_memcg_data_flags can never be used for slab pages I think
overlapping these bits is not a good idea and creates additional
risks. Unless there is a good reason to do this I would advise against
it.
Completely disagree. You both missed the long discussion
during v4. The other alternative was to increase alignment
and waste memory. Saving the bit is obviously cleaner.
The next patch is using the saved bit.

Suren is
fixing the condition of VM_BUG_ON_PAGE() in slab_obj_exts(). With this
patch, I think, that condition will need to be changed again.
That's orthogonal and I'm not convinced it's correct.
slab_obj_exts() is doing the right thing. afaict.
Currently we have 

VM_BUG_ON_PAGE(obj_exts && !(obj_exts & MEMCG_DATA_OBJEXTS))

but it should be (before your patch) something like:

VM_BUG_ON_PAGE(obj_exts && !(obj_exts & (MEMCG_DATA_OBJEXTS | OBJEXTS_ALLOC_FAIL)))

After your patch, hmmm, the previous one would be right again and the
newer one will be the same as the previous due to aliasing. This patch
doesn't need to touch that VM_BUG. Older kernels will need to move to
the second condition though.
